Step-by-Step Guide to Writing the Cursive L Uppercase Letter
Writing the Cursive L Uppercase letter involves a series of precise strokes and movements. Follow these steps to master the technique:
Step 1: Start with the Basic Stroke
Begin by positioning your pen at the top left corner of the line. Draw a straight line downwards, stopping at the baseline. This forms the main body of the letter.
Step 2: Create the Loop
From the baseline, curve the pen upwards and to the right, forming a loop that extends slightly above the midline. This loop is a distinctive feature of the Cursive L Uppercase letter.
Step 3: Complete the Letter
After completing the loop, bring the pen back down to the baseline, creating a small tail that connects to the next letter. This tail helps in maintaining the flow of cursive writing.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When learning to write the Cursive L Uppercase letter, it’s essential to avoid common mistakes that can hinder your progress:
- Inconsistent Sizing: Ensure that your letter size is consistent with the rest of your cursive writing.
- Poor Loop Formation: The loop should be smooth and well-defined. Avoid making it too small or too large.
- Lack of Connection: Make sure the tail of the letter connects smoothly to the next letter.
